Die-Cut Window Templates
Bread paper bags are gaining popularity, and some of them feature window designs so that the customers can see what is inside the package. Packaging designers custom-make the shape of their windows using die-cutting panels and vector software, such as ones that are in the form of ovals, rectangles, and even brand-inspired shapes. Not only do they serve as visual obtrusions, but they can also arouse a sense of freshness and customer confidence in the product. These windows, in combination with biodegradable plastic or cellulose films, uphold sustainability without affecting usefulness.

Green Ink Systems
Custom bread paper bags innovation is all about sustainability. Designers have incorporated eco print inks made of soy or water-based inks, which are printed through low-waste customer-specific printers. Such inks guarantee good quality print performance without reducing their recyclability. This, along with the use of Kraft bread paper bags, helps make the packaging completely compostable.Thiss is in line with the increasing demand by consumers towards green solutions.
3D Mockup Generators
The software associated with 3D prototyping allows the designers to have a proper look at the type of design that will appear in the actual design environment, but they are not ready to commit to production. Such tools include simulation of folding, branding, transparency, and sizing. When designing regular loaves or unusual loaves shaped bags of sourdough bread, mockup tools assist in perfect fitting and appearance. This minimizes wastage and accelerates the design-to-production process.
